iOS服务器交互安全:端口防护与数据加密策略指南
|
在iOS应用开发中,服务器交互安全是保障用户数据和系统稳定性的关键环节。随着移动设备的普及,攻击者对iOS应用与后端服务器之间的通信进行窃听或篡改的风险也在增加。因此,合理配置端口防护和实施有效的数据加密策略显得尤为重要。 端口防护是防止未经授权访问的第一道防线。开发者应避免使用默认端口(如80、443),并根据实际需求设置自定义端口。同时,建议通过防火墙规则限制特定IP地址或网络段的访问权限,减少潜在的攻击面。定期扫描开放端口并更新安全策略,可以有效降低被利用的可能性。
AI绘图结果,仅供参考 数据加密则是保护传输内容的核心手段。iOS应用应优先采用HTTPS协议,确保数据在传输过程中不被窃取或篡改。对于敏感信息,如用户密码、身份验证令牌等,应使用强加密算法(如AES-256)进行本地存储和网络传输。同时,建议在服务器端也部署TLS 1.2或更高版本的加密协议,以提升整体安全性。 除了技术层面的防护,还应关注API接口的安全设计。例如,对请求参数进行校验,防止SQL注入或XSS攻击;使用一次性令牌(如JWT)替代长期凭证,减少因凭证泄露带来的风险。通过速率限制和访问控制机制,可有效防止恶意请求对服务器造成过载。 站长个人见解,iOS服务器交互安全需要从端口防护和数据加密两方面入手,结合合理的架构设计和持续的安全监控,才能构建出更稳固的通信体系,保障用户隐私和业务稳定。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

